Діаграма варіантів використання

Інформація про навчальний заклад

ВУЗ:
Національний університет Львівська політехніка
Інститут:
Не вказано
Факультет:
Не вказано
Кафедра:
Кафедра програмного забезпечення

Інформація про роботу

Рік:
2010
Тип роботи:
Звіт
Предмет:
Моделювання
Група:
ПІ

Частина тексту файла

МІНІСТЕРСТВО ОСВІТИ УКРАЇНИ НАЦІОНАЛЬНИЙ УНІВЕРСИТЕТ “ЛЬВІВСЬКА ПОЛІТЕХНІКА” КАФЕДРА ПРОГРАМНОГО ЗАБЕЗПЕЧЕННЯ Звіт До лабораторної роботи № 6 На тему: “ Діаграма варіантів використання ” З дисципліни: "Моделювання програмного забезпечення" Мета роботи: Зобразити діаграму варіантів використання для обраної інформаційної системи. Теоретична частина Варіант використання являє собою характерну процедуру застосування розроблювальної системи конкретною діючою особою, у якості якого можуть виступати не тільки люди, але й інші системи або пристрої. Діаграми варіантів використання дозволяють наочно представити очікувану поведінку системи. Розробка діаграми варіантів використання переслідує мету: Визначити загальні межі і контекст модельованої наочної області на початкових етапах проектування системи. Сформулювати загальні вимоги до функційної поведінки проектованої системи. Розробити початкову концептуальну модель системи для її подальшої деталізації у формі логічних і фізичних моделей. Підготувати початкову документацію для взаємодії розробників системи з її замовниками і користувачами. Суть даної діаграми полягає в наступному: проектована система представляється у вигляді множини сутностей або акторів, що взаємодіють з системою за допомогою варіантів використання. При цьому актором або дійовою особою називається будь-яка сутність, що взаємодіє з системою ззовні. У свою чергу, варіант використання служить для опису сервісів, які система надає актору. Іншими словами, кожен варіант використання визначає деякий набір дій, ініційованих системою при діалозі з актором. При цьому нічого не говориться про те, яким чином буде реалізована взаємодія акторів з системою. Основними поняттями діаграм варіантів використання є: діюча особа, варіант використання, зв'язок. Діюча особа (актор) – зовнішня стосовно розроблювального програмного забезпечення сутність, що взаємодіє з ним з метою одержання або надання якої-небудь інформації. Діючими особами можуть бути користувачі, інше програмне забезпечення або які-небудь технічні засоби, взаємодіючі з розроблювальним програмним забезпеченням. Варіант використання – деяка очевидна для діючої особи процедура, що вирішує його конкретне завдання. Всі варіанти використання, так чи інакше, пов'язані з функціональними вимогами до розроблювальної системи й можуть сильно відрізнятися за обсягом виконуваної роботи. Зв'язок – взаємодія діючих осіб і відповідних варіантів використання. На рис. 1 наведені умовні позначки, які застосовують при зображенні діаграм варіантів використання.  Рис. 3. Основні умовні позначення діаграм варіантів використання а – дійова особа; б – варіант використання; в – зв’язок Основні варіанти використання для офіційного сайту кінотеатру 3.1. Реєстрація Головний актор: Гість Рівень взаємодії: Гість – Система Передумова: Гість зайшов на сайт. Основний сценарій: 1. Користувач відкриває сторінку реєстрації. 2. Заповнює необхідні дані про себе. 3. Підтверджує вибір. 4. Дані зберігаються в базі даних. Помилки: 2.а. Користувач не заповнив всі поля з обов’язковими для реєстрації даними. 3.а. Користувач замість підтвердження відмінив свої дії. Альтернативний сценарій: 2.а. Система видає повідомлення користувачу про те що не всі поля обов’язкові для реєстрації заповнені. Користувачу надається можливість заповнити пропущені дані. 3.а. Користувач залишається з правами гостя. 3.2. Замовлення квитка зареєстрованим користувачем. Головний актор: Зареєстрований користувач. Рівень взаємодії: Зареєстрований користувач – Система Передумова: Зареєстрований користувач зайшов на сайт під своїм логіном і паролем. Основний сценарій: 1.Користувач відкриває сторінку з замовленням квитків. 2. Вводить необхідні дані для замовлення квитка(ряд, місце, назва фільму). 3. Підтверджує вибір. Помилки: 2.а. Користувач ввів неправильні дані для замовлення квитка. 2.в. Квиток на місце яке замовив користувач продано. Альтернативний сценарій: 2.а Користувачу пропонується ввести дані ще раз( виводиться повідомленн...
Антиботан аватар за замовчуванням

01.01.1970 03:01

Коментарі

Ви не можете залишити коментар. Для цього, будь ласка, увійдіть або зареєструйтесь.

Завантаження файлу

Якщо Ви маєте на своєму комп'ютері файли, пов'язані з навчанням( розрахункові, лабораторні, практичні, контрольні роботи та інше...), і Вам не шкода ними поділитись - то скористайтесь формою для завантаження файлу, попередньо заархівувавши все в архів .rar або .zip розміром до 100мб, і до нього невдовзі отримають доступ студенти всієї України! Ви отримаєте грошову винагороду в кінці місяця, якщо станете одним з трьох переможців!
Стань активним учасником руху antibotan!
Поділись актуальною інформацією,
і отримай привілеї у користуванні архівом! Детальніше

Оголошення від адміністратора

Антиботан аватар за замовчуванням

пропонує роботу

Admin

26.02.2019 12:38

Привіт усім учасникам нашого порталу! Хороші новини - з‘явилась можливість кожному заробити на своїх знаннях та вміннях. Тепер Ви можете продавати свої роботи на сайті заробляючи кошти, рейтинг і довіру користувачів. Потрібно завантажити роботу, вказати ціну і додати один інформативний скріншот з деякими частинами виконаних завдань. Навіть одна якісна і всім необхідна робота може продатися сотні разів. «Головою заробляти» продуктивніше ніж руками! :-)

Новини